WebDiscussion: Rates of lithium evaporation show an Arrhenian behaviour between 1400-1650°C at log fO2 varying from -5.9 to -6.9. The activation energy for lithium evaporation is approximately 150 kJ.mol-1. Furthermore, the rate is also proportional to fO2-1/4 within the range of fO2 from 10-6.9 to 10-5.9 at 1550- 1600°C.

WebIn Atacama, the evaporation process concentrates lithium from 0.15% to 6% (40 times) in 12-18 months; so evaporation is expected to take much longer in Uyuni, especially if it rains as hard as it did recently, when it flooded the pilot plant evaporation ponds.
